Letter to the Editor: Mannan for Select Board

by | Apr 20, 2022 | Letter to Editor

What does it take for us to feel that a candidate for Select Board will represent the community well?

I ask because we have a candidate on the ballot who has served on a multitude of town boards over seven years — Appropriation Committee and Planning Board are two with much responsibility — shows up for all community events with his family, be it the 20th anniversary of 9/11 or Holiday Stroll or Marathon Day, opens his home and hearth for civic discussions and celebrations, has consistently been engaged on varied community matters, listens intently and raises thoughtful questions in a respectful manner, is even-keeled and well-accomplished in his professional life, and has expressed a deep desire to serve on the Select Board. If this is not the voice and candidate we want to see on the Select Board, I must ask why?

Please join me in voting for the very wise, accomplished member of our community with a proven track record of service, Shahidul Mannan.

— Meena Bharath, Hopkinton
